In order to not trigger a compilation cascade, gfortran only overwrites a .mod file when its MD5 sum has changed.
Seemingly, the mod-file versioning has the side effect that the MOD file is not overwritten if there are no other changes but the version number, which causes the version-mismatch error. I'm not sure whether this is a problem between 4.x and 4.(x+1) versions as the .mod file probably has changed in an incompatible way (different MD5 sum), but still it is annoying. Expected: If the version number does not match, the file is written nevertheless.
